A Flexible Degree with a Creative Edge

A double major in Art allows students to explore their creative practice while developing expertise in another field, often completing both degrees within four years with careful planning. Pairing Art with disciplines like Business, Environmental Science, Psychology, or Communications can expand career opportunities in areas such as design, arts administration, therapy, or marketing. Alternatively, students can pursue a minor in another field, complementing their artistic skills without the additional coursework required for a full second major. This flexibility allows for a well-rounded education while maintaining a strong focus on creative development.

Why double major in art?

An art degree enhances your other major by fostering creative thinking, problem-solving, and interdisciplinary skills that can be applied across diverse fields. It also provides a unique perspective and a competitive edge, allowing you to approach challenges in your other discipline with innovation and a fresh viewpoint.
